Anyone know of any work arounds? Maye I should downgrade thunderbird?
Can someone point me towards how to downgrade a single package?
You could go here and get the appropriate version for your system:
https://koji.fedoraproject.org/koji/packageinfo?packageID=39
Then, in the directory where you downloaded the package, run
dnf -C downgrade [package name]
I notice that there is a later version of thunderbird there that you
could update with
dnf -C update [package name]
